Intermittent Versus Continuous Venetoclax With Acalabrutinib for CLL/SLL

This is a randomized Phase II study of intermittent versus continuous venetoclax therapy with Acalabrutinib in previously untreated Chronic Lymphocytic Leukemia/Small Lymphocytic Lymphoma (CLL/SLL)
